This DanDoh signature cable dropped-stitch design makes an eye-catching piece. This stitch pattern combines cables and dropped stitches. You will drop a stitch when you cross stitches for a cable. If you know how to work cables, you are good to go!
The pattern is available with Silk+ yarn and Linen yarn.
Here is the difference between Forest Weave with Silk+ yarn and with Linen yarn.
<The Silk+ version> (this one)
It is lighter and has a more casual look because of the yarn characteristics. The pattern comes with short and long sleeve options.
<The Linen version> (click here)
It looks more elegant. It drapes and would be a little longer when it is worn because of the weight and fiber. For this reason, you might prefer to make a shorter length than you usually make. Overall, it’s a heavier top, and the pattern comes with short sleeves and sleeveless options.

FINISHED MEASUREMENTS
Chest: 44 [48, 52, 56, 60]"/110 [120, 130, 140, 150]cm
Length (laid flat): Choice of 15", 19", 21", 23", or 26"/37.5cm, 47.5cm, 52.5m, 57.5cm, or 65cm
Choose the chest size based on your ease preference and length.

DANDOH YARN
15" length: 4 [4, 4, 4, 4] skeins or 688 [722, 778, 823, 868]yds
19" length: 4 [4, 5, 5, 5] skeins or 836 [894, 951, 1008, 1065]yds
21" length: 4 [5, 5, 5, 6] skeins or 900 [962, 1025, 1087, 1149]yds
23" length: 5 [5, 5, 6, 6] skeins or 964 [1032, 1099, 1166, 1234]yds
26" length: 5 [6, 6, 6, 7] skeins or 1070 [1146, 1222, 1298, 1375]yds
These amounts are for a short sleeve top. For longer sleeves like the photo, you need 1 skein more.
